Hardscaping Installation in Fairfield County, CT
Hardscaping installation involves adding durable, functional features to outdoor spaces using materials like stone, brick, concrete, or pavers. Common projects include creating pat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or living areas. These installations enhance a property's appearance, improve accessibility, and provide long-lasting solutions for outdoor functionality.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of materials available, the planning process involved, and how these features can complement existing landscape designs before requesting services.
Property owners should consider the size and layout of the area, the intended use of the space, and the durability of different materials when exploring hardscaping options. It’s important to think about drainage, soil conditions, and integration with existing landscaping to ensure a successful installation. Understanding the maintenance requirements and overall aesthetic goals can help in selecting the right features that add value and curb appeal to a home or property.

Hardscaping Installation Questions
What types of hardscaping projects are common? Common proj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or fireplaces to enhance functionality and aesthetics.
What materials are typically used in hardscaping? Materials such as pavers, natural stone, concrete, and brick are frequently used for durability and visual appeal.
How does hardscaping improve property value? Well-designed hardscaping adds curb appeal and outdoor living space, which can increase overall property value.
Is hardscaping suitable for any yard size? Hardscaping can be tailored to fit yards of various sizes, from small patios to large outdoor entertainment areas.
